Система проектирования агент-ориентированных моделей для запуска на суперкомпьютерах

Certificate.jpg

Разработана система проектирования агент-ориентированных моделей для запуска на суперкомпьютерах, позволяющая эффективно масштабировать агент-ориентированные модели до 1 млрд. агентов. Она была применена при реализации крупномасштабной агентной модели стран Евразии, имитирующей основные процессы движения населения этих стран, а также последствия реализации крупных инфраструктурных проектов как результата действий множества самостоятельных агентов. Тестирование модели было проведено на различных суперкомпьютерах (Ломоносов (МГУ), Млечный путь-2 (Гуанчжоу, Китай)).

Основные компоненты системы:

  • подсистема алгоритмов, имитирующих типовую структуру и взаимодействие основных элементов социально-экономических агентов разного уровня;
  • подсистема алгоритмов, имитирующих основные элементы поведения агентов (обработка информации о внешней среде и внутреннем состоянии, принятие решений);
  • подсистема алгоритмов и протоколов взаимодействия агентов разных типов;
  • процедуры создания сетей на множестве агентов;
  • процедуры декомпозиции модели на этих сетях для эффективного распараллеливания работы модели на суперкомпьютерах (минимизация обмена информацией между отдельными процессами и обеспечение динамической равномерности распределения нагрузки по используемым процессорам);
  • подсистема алгоритмов агрегирования характеристик и состояний агентов по иерархии и синхронизации их реакции.

Агент-ориентированность Искусственные общества Суперкомпьютеры